this is a bit off topic but it does begin at KAYS jewelers in Aruba.
A few years ago I was looking to replace a gold claddagh ring that I had lost.
I went to KAYS in Aruba, and the gentleman there said no that they ad none, but he would make some inquiries.
He took my Aruba # and my email.
He told me that he put the word out to some of his jeweler friends.
Right before we left AUA he emailed me and gave me the name and email of a jeweler in the USA that deals in lots of estate jewelry and he had a nice selection of new and estate claddagh rings. I contacted the jeweler and asked if he could send me some photos of the selections. He did, and then I noticed the name of the store. It was our local jeweler here in Lakeland............ MUNCHELS.
Hahahahaha I had to go to Aruba to be referred back to Lakeland
I got a ring!
